About evermore

evermoreis a technology company that administers Smart Benefits to connect people to products and services they need, when they need them, so they can live healthier lives. We partner with payers and retailers to deliver expansive benefits for things like healthy foods, OTC medications, or transportation. evermore is reinventing benefits administration so that everyone benefits with more value for each and better outcomes for all. evermore is a Series B stage company, backed by leading investors including General Catalyst, Define Ventures, Lightspeed Venture Partners, Pinegrove Capital Partners, and Qiming Venture Partners. 

The Job at a Glance 

Reporting to the Associate Director, Merchants & Payments, you will own the relationship with our issuing bank and payment processing partners. On behalf of our clients, you will navigate the rules and standards of both the issuing bank and the payment network. You will ensure that all sponsor implementations are conducted consistent with the company’s policies, procedures, and to allow our carded benefit programs to launch successfully, and you will have primary accountability for managing this operation on a day-to-day basis. You will serve as a trusted thought partner to both our clients and internal stakeholders on matters related to program design, KYB/AML practices, funding account operations, reconcilation / settlement, collateral, marketing materials, fraud management, and dispute resolution, and many others.

What You Will Do 

Working within an organization created at the intersection of health care, retail and financial technology, no two days will look the sameTypical responsibilities of the role include:  

  • Own the day-to-day relationship between evermore and both our issuing bank and payment processing partners, acting as their primary point of contact for all matters. 
  • Manage external relationships with clients and vendor partners at an A+ level and maintain flawless execution of ongoing operational functions, including: 
  • KYB/AML Practices 
  • Funding Account Operations 
  • Network Reconciliation and Settlement 
  • Vendor / Issue Management 
  • Operations Escalations / Fraud Investigations 
  • Collateral Review 
  • Own critical pieces of implementation for new card programs, including: 
  • Conducting Know Your Business (KYB) / Due Diligence for new programs and ensuring Anti-Money Laundering (AML) Compliance. 
  • Setting up funding accounts for our plan sponsors, and ensuring all necessary configurations and documentation are in place with our bank and processing partners 
  • Track funding account balances and coordinate timely reloads with the relevant internal and external partners 
  • Reviewing program collateral for compliance with bank requirements and ensuring final review & approval by our bank partners 
  • Obtaining final bank approval for program launch 
  • Own and maintain crisp process documentation for core card program management functions in alignment with compliance-driven policies, including: 
  • Know Your Business (KYB) Verification & Customer Due Diligence 
  • Anti-Money Laundering (AML) Compliance 
  • Regulatory Licensing and Reporting 
  • Maintain hyper-organized client documentation (collateral, regulatory forms, approvals, etc.). 
  • Establish strong relationships with Solutions, Finance, Legal & Compliance, Product, Engineering, Account Management, and other key business partners. Act as a liaison between these groups and ensure comprehensive and timely communication of projects to all relevant stakeholders. 
  • Gain a deep understanding of evermore’s existing tools and program management infrastructure, which will allow you to develop strategies to improve our program efficiency, drive the implementation of new solutions, and ensure updated processes are aligned with internal stakeholders and external partners.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
